Features and Benefits
-
Petite Cap Size: Designed to fit head circumferences of 21-21.5 inches, ensuring a comfortable and secure fit.
-
Natural Hairline: Mimics the natural growth pattern for a realistic look.
-
Adjustable Straps: Allow for a customized fit for maximum comfort.
-
Heat-Resistant Fiber: Can be styled with heat tools for endless styling options.

Tips and Tricks
-
Store Your Wig Properly: Keep your wig on a mannequin or wig stand to maintain its shape.
-
Brush Regularly: Brush your wig gently to prevent tangles and maintain its shape.
-
Wash Infrequently: Wash your wig every 6-8 wears to preserve its quality.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
-
Overtightening the Straps: Avoid pulling the straps too tightly, as this can cause discomfort.
-
Using Heat Too High: Follow the manufacturer's instructions for heat styling to avoid damaging the fibers.
-
Washing Too Frequently: Excessive washing can strip away the natural oils and damage the wig.
Advanced Features
-
Monofilament Top: Creates a natural-looking scalp illusion.
-
Lace Front: Provides a realistic hairline with seamless blending.
-
Hand-Tied Cap: Offers a breathable and comfortable fit.
